Angiostomy cannulas are medical devices designed to maintain vascular access during angiostomy procedures, enabling efficient infusion, drainage, and pressure monitoring. Constructed from biocompatible polymers, these cannulas reduce the risk of thrombosis and infection while offering flexibility, kink resistance, and precise tip placement. Angiostomy Cannula Market is estimated to be valued at USD 202.3 Mn in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 322.7 Mn in 2032,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.9% from 2025 to 2032.

Market drivers
The primary driver fueling the Angiostomy Cannula Market Demand is the escalating prevalence of cardiovascular diseases (CVDs) worldwide, which elevates the demand for vascular access devices in diagnostic and therapeutic interventions. According to industry reports, CVDs are responsible for a significant percentage of global mortality, prompting healthcare providers to adopt angiostomy techniques for rapid, reliable vascular entry. Minimally invasive procedures, such as percutaneous transluminal angioplasty and stent placement, rely heavily on high-performance cannulas to deliver contrast media, medications, and guide wires with precision. Additionally, the trend toward outpatient surgical centers and same-day discharge protocols drives up procedural volumes, creating robust market growth. Improved reimbursement policies and favorable regulatory frameworks in developed markets further support adoption, while ongoing clinical trials and product approvals expand market scope. Current Challenges
The Angiostomy Cannula market faces several immediate hurdles that influence its overall market dynamics. Stringent regulatory requirements across different jurisdictions can slow product approvals, requiring extensive clinical data and rigorous quality control. Supply chain disruptions—driven by raw material shortages, logistical bottlenecks, and fluctuating manufacturing costs—pose serious market restraints, complicating production planning for medical device companies. Additionally, fierce competition from alternative vascular access technologies pressures market players to continuously refine device design and reduce per-unit costs, affecting overall profitability. Limited clinician training and awareness in emerging economies further restrict market growth, as healthcare providers may hesitate to adopt specialized equipment without hands-on workshops or robust clinical support. Reimbursement policies also vary widely, with some regions offering inadequate coverage for advanced cannula procedures. This uneven landscape creates pockets of low adoption despite growing medical need. Finally, concerns over infection control and biocompatibility standards push R&D teams toward more sophisticated materials, stretching budgets and elongating time-to-market.
